Package | Description |
---|---|
com.bstek.dorado.data.config.xml |
实现XML型数据配置文件的读取和解析相关的功能。
|
com.bstek.dorado.view.config.xml |
实现XML型视图配置文件的读取和解析相关的对象。
|
Modifier and Type | Method and Description |
---|---|
protected DataType |
DataElementParserSupport.getCurrentDataType(DataParseContext context)
根据解析上下文中的状态返回当前数据节点的目标DataType。
|
DefinitionReference<DataProviderDefinition> |
DataParseContext.getDataProviderReference(java.lang.String name,
DataParseContext context)
根据DataProvider的名称生成一个指向某DataProvider配置声明对象的引用。
|
DefinitionReference<DataResolverDefinition> |
DataParseContext.getDataResolverReference(java.lang.String name,
DataParseContext context)
根据DataResolver的名称生成一个指向某DataResolver配置声明对象的引用。
|
DefinitionReference<DataTypeDefinition> |
DataObjectParseHelper.getDataTypeByName(java.lang.String name,
DataParseContext context,
boolean subDataTypeAllowed)
根据DataType的名称返回一个指向某DataType配置声明对象的引用。
如果被引用的DataType确有定义但尚未被解析,那么此方法会立即尝试对该DataType的配置信息进行解析。 |
DefinitionReference<DataProviderDefinition> |
DataObjectParseHelper.getReferencedDataProvider(java.lang.String propertyName,
org.w3c.dom.Element element,
DataParseContext context)
尝试获得一个XML节点引用到某个DataProvider,并返回指向该DataProvider配置声明的引用。
注意,此处所说的DataProvider可能是XML节点内部定义的私有DataProvider。 |
DefinitionReference<DataResolverDefinition> |
DataObjectParseHelper.getReferencedDataResolver(java.lang.String propertyName,
org.w3c.dom.Element element,
DataParseContext context)
尝试获得一个XML节点引用到某个DataResolver,并返回指向该DataResolver配置声明的引用。
注意,此处所说的DataResolver可能是XML节点内部定义的私有DataResolver。 |
DefinitionReference<DataTypeDefinition> |
DataObjectParseHelper.getReferencedDataType(java.lang.String propertyName,
org.w3c.dom.Element element,
DataParseContext context)
尝试获得一个XML节点引用到某个DataType,并返回指向该DataType配置声明的引用。
|
protected java.lang.Object |
DataCollectionParser.internalParse(org.w3c.dom.Node node,
DataParseContext context) |
protected java.lang.Object |
DataElementParser.internalParse(org.w3c.dom.Node node,
DataParseContext context) |
protected java.lang.Object |
EntityParser.internalParse(org.w3c.dom.Node node,
DataParseContext context) |
protected java.lang.Object |
GenericParser.internalParse(org.w3c.dom.Node node,
DataParseContext context)
内部使用的XML节点解析方法。
|
protected java.lang.Object |
StaticPropertyParser.internalParse(org.w3c.dom.Node node,
DataParseContext context) |
protected java.lang.Object |
ValueParser.internalParse(org.w3c.dom.Node node,
DataParseContext context) |
protected java.lang.Object |
DataElementParserSupport.parseValueFromText(java.lang.String valueText,
DataParseContext context)
将一段文本类型的配置信息转化为与目标DataType向匹配的类型,目标DataType是根据解析上下文中的状态获得的。
|
Modifier and Type | Class and Description |
---|---|
class |
ViewParseContext
视图配置文件的解析上下文。
|
Modifier and Type | Method and Description |
---|---|
protected java.lang.Object |
ItemsParser.internalParse(org.w3c.dom.Node node,
DataParseContext context) |
Copyright © 2001-2011 www.BSTEK.com All Rights Reserved.